Abstract:

Co۳O۴ Nanoparticles have potential photocatalytic activity against wase water containing organic pollutants. In this study, a synthesis of Co۳O۴ crystals with the best morphology was employed to enhance its photocatalytic performance. The pathetic parameters (several capping agents and calcination) on the synthesis method were studied. Indeed, Co۳O۴ NPS declined EY around ۷۵% in ۱۸۰min of sun illumination and ۸۱% in ۹۰min UV illumination. The manufactured nanoparticles were distinguished utilizing XRD, FE-SEM, EDX, CV, VSM, BET, TEM, FTIR, and UV spectroscopy
